Thought Leadership Summits’ Telecommunications & Media Customer Strategy Summit 2006 brought together senior-level attendees from Fixed-Line, Wireless, Internet Provider, LEC, Data Network, and Cable TV and Media companies.

Spread over two days, the Summit 2006 consisted of real world case studies and interactive panel discussions focused on how improved sales, service, marketing and information technology practices are helping the best run Telecommunications & Media companies differentiate themselves and create a competitive advantage.

The Summit attendees and speakers were executives focused on Sales, Service, Marketing, Customer Relationship Management (CRM) and Information Technology. In addition to presentations by innovative Telecommunication & Media companies, thought leaders from key analyst companies, industry institutions, and academia provided their perspectives.

The Summit created a unique opportunity for attendees and speakers to discuss their challenges and successes, and share their best practices and future visions as they relate to enhanced field service execution, greater sales & marketing effectiveness and consistent and timely customer support.
